Tiffany Haddish has partnered with sports content studio Game1 to produce and star as Olympic Gold-winning track and field icon, Florence “Flo-Jo” Griffith Joyner.

Photo by Tony Duffy/Allsport/Getty Images

According to the announcement obtained by The Hollywood Reporter, the Night School actress will portray Flo-Jo in the feature that “will chronicle the remarkable life and untimely death of the global track and field superstar, not only showcasing Flo-Jo’s dominant and historic Olympic performances, but also her enduring impact on the entire world of sports and in the communities that needed her help and inspiration the most.”

“I am looking forward to telling Flo-Jo’s story the way it should be told,” said Haddish. “My goal with this film is making sure that younger generations know my ‘she-ro’ Flo-Jo, the fastest woman in the world to this day, existed.”

The Emmy award-winning actress has already begun training for the role with the help of Joyner’s widow and former coach, Al Joyner. He will also serve as a producer and creative consultant on the biopic.

“Working with Tiffany has been a great pleasure — she is incredibly dedicated, focused, and committed to portraying the spirit of Florence accurately, whose legacy of making a difference in the world will live on for generations to come,” said Joyner. “I hope that this film touches all who see it and inspires people to be the change the world so desperately needs right now!”
